5.0 out of 5 stars Terrific song, November 23, 2008
This review is from: Come Back to Me (MP3 Download)
This is an incredibly well-crafted song - beautiful lyrics, catchy tune, rock power for a bite, and, of course, David Cook's voice that ties it all together giving it meaning and substance. It is no coincidence that this song has been reviewed by professional critics as being U2esque. The song soars and stays with you like a nice warm ember.

2.0 out of 5 stars too Pop, November 23, 2008
By 
Mary E. Mcculley "Mary" (Redondo Beach, CA United States) - See all my reviews
(REAL NAME)   
This review is from: Come Back to Me (MP3 Download)
I love this album, but this is my least favorite song on the album. One of the only 2 not penned by David Cook, it's clearly written to appeal to people who love the "pop" genre and not much else. The lyrics are simplistic, but the tune is catchy and hence it's popularity. I would recommend "Avalanche" as a much better written and beautiful romantic song on this album.
